タグ

Smartyに関するyoshi-naのブックマーク (2)

  • Dreamwerver で Smarty – masha.webTechLog

    Dreamwerver上でSmartyを扱いたい。 求める機能は以下4点。 ・TPLファイルを関連付けさせる ・ヘッダーなどの<{include file="○○.tpl"}>を、デザインビュー上できちんと表示させる ・独自デリミタ(<{~}>)に対応させる ・CSSJavascriptの読み込みに対応させ、画像もデザインビュー上で表示させる いろいろ探したのだが、各方法一長一短。 どうにも設定が反映されないことも多く、半日以上右往左往_|\●_ 3つの方法を組み合わせつつ、やっとこさまぁまぁの環境を実現。。 以下メモ。。。 ■手順1■ まずは、Macromedia Extension Managerを使って以下のエクステンションをインストール。 →DreamweaverでSmarty テンプレートをイケてる感じで編集しよう。 エクステンションなので簡単にインストールできます(感謝☆)。

  • Smartyでテンプレートエンジンの威力を知る(1/3) − @IT

    テンプレートが果たす役割 改まったビジネス文書や手紙の作成にはしばしば、テンプレートが利用されます。テンプレートに差出人や相手方の情報を入力するだけで、気の利いた季節のあいさつや丁寧な結びの句を織り交ぜた文書を簡単に作成することができます。 さて、PHPHTMLタグとPHPコードが共存できることを特徴とし、多くの利用者を獲得してきました。しかしPHPコードが冗長になるにつれ、HTMLの記述が複雑になり、デザインの修正が難しくなる傾向があります。 そこでPHPにおいても、文書テンプレートのアイデアを取り入れた「テンプレートエンジン」が利用されます。 テンプレートエンジンを利用すれば、PHPコードで作られたロジックが吐き出す値を、HTMLデザインを分離したテンプレートに埋め込むことが可能になります。この結果、ロジックを作成する作業と、HTMLデザインを編集する作業を分担して行うことが可能にな

    Smartyでテンプレートエンジンの威力を知る(1/3) − @IT
  • 1